Media Bias Fact Check selects and publishes fact checks from around the world. We only utilize fact-checkers who are either a signatory of the International Fact-Checking Network (IFCN) or have been verified as credible by MBFC. Further, we review each fact check for accuracy before publishing. We fact-check the fact-checkers and let you know their bias. When appropriate, we explain the rating and/or offer our own rating if we disagree with the fact-checker. (D. Van Zandt)

FALSE Claim by Joe Biden (D): Trump “wants to get rid of Social Security, he thinks there’s plenty to cut in Social Security.”

PolitiFact rating: False (his campaign website says that not “a single penny” should be cut from Social Security, and he’s repeated similar lines in campaign rallies.)

Claim by The Exposé: Covid-19 vaccines caused 14,000 percent increase in US cancer cases.

AFP Fact Check rating: False

Anti-vaccine website falsely claims Covid jabs behind cancer uptick

FALSE Claim by Donald Trump (R): “I gave you the largest tax cut in history.”

PolitiFact rating: False (When it was passed in 2017, Trump’s tax cut was, in inflation-adjusted dollars, the fourth-largest since 1940. And as a percentage of gross domestic product, it ranked seventh in history.)

Claim by Joe Biden (D): “I said I’d never raise the tax on anybody if you’re making less than $400,000. I didn’t.”

PolitiFact rating: Mostly True (He has not raised any individual income taxes on Americans earning less than $400,000 a year. It’s always possible that individual taxpayers could see increases because of changes in their personal circumstances.)

FALSE (International: Palestine): Bombs that look like cans of food and explode on opening were planted in a Palestinian school by Israeli soldiers.

Australian Associated Press rating: False (The cans are containers for detonators and do not explode on opening.)

Experts dismiss ‘exploding cans’ claim – Australian Associated Press
